Exploring Storage Unit Sizes and Types
When choosing a short-term storage unit in Homewood, how do you decide on the right size and type?
First, consider your items and measure them to understand the necessary unit dimensions. If you’re storing a few boxes or small furniture, a 5×5 unit might suffice.
Need more space? A 10×10 unit can fit the contents of an entire room or a small apartment.
Next, think about the storage types. Do you need climate control for sensitive items like electronics or documents? If so, verify your chosen facility offers that option.
Alternatively, if your items are more durable, a standard unit might work just fine.

Key Features to Look for in a Storage Facility
Choosing the right storage facility involves considering several key features to ascertain it meets your specific needs.
First, check if the facility offers climate control. This feature is essential for protecting your belongings from extreme temperatures and humidity, especially if you’re storing delicate items like electronics, artwork, or important documents.
Next, evaluate the access hours. You’ll want a facility that offers flexible access so you can retrieve or store items at your convenience, whether that’s early mornings or late evenings.
Also, consider security measures like surveillance cameras, gated access, and on-site staff to guarantee your items are safe.
Finally, assess the facility’s location and cleanliness, as a well-maintained storage unit close to home or work can make your experience seamless.
How to Pack and Organize Your Items for Storage
Packing and organizing your items for storage can be simplified with a few strategic steps. Start by gathering essential packing materials like sturdy boxes, bubble wrap, and packing tape.
Label each box clearly to save time later. Use organization tips such as grouping similar items together and placing heavier items at the bottom. This not only maximizes space but also guarantees easy access when needed.
Consider using clear plastic bins for visibility and protection against moisture. Create an inventory list to keep track of what you’re storing.
Shelving can help keep your storage unit neat and accessible. By taking the time to plan and organize, you’ll make the most of your storage space and easily find your belongings when it’s time to retrieve them.
Securing Your Belongings in a Storage Unit
When securing your belongings in a storage unit, make certain you take measures that protect them from theft and damage.
Start by choosing a facility with strong security measures, such as surveillance cameras, gated access, and well-lit surroundings. Opt for a high-quality lock to add an extra layer of protection.
Consider insurance options to cover your items in case of unforeseen incidents. Many storage facilities offer insurance plans, but you can also explore your homeowner’s or renter’s policy to see if your items are covered.
Clearly label your boxes and create an inventory list to keep track of everything. This step not only helps in organizing but also aids in filing claims if needed.

Comparing Storage Rental Prices and Terms
How do you get the best value for your money when renting a storage unit? Start with a thorough storage price comparison. Check multiple facilities in Homewood to see how their rates stack up. Don’t just look at the base price; consider any additional fees, such as deposits or late charges. Look for promotions or discounts that might lower your costs.
Next, scrutinize the rental agreement terms with care. Understand the length of commitment required and whether you can go month-to-month. Are there penalties for early termination? Some agreements might include insurance, so verify what’s covered.
Ascertain you’re clear on access hours and any restrictions. By comparing prices and terms, you can find a storage solution that meets your needs without breaking the bank.

How Do Storage Unit Auctions Work?
When you attend a storage unit auction, you’re diving into a unique auction process.
First, the storage facility announces the auction. On auction day, you’ll join others to view the unit’s contents briefly.
Then, the storage unit bidding begins. You’ll hear bids called out, and when the highest bid wins, that person gets the entire unit’s contents.
Can I Store Vehicles in a Short-Term Storage Unit?
Yes, you can store vehicles in a short-term storage unit. Many facilities offer vehicle storage options specifically designed for cars, motorcycles, or small boats.
When considering short-term rentals, check the unit’s size, access, and security features to guarantee it meets your needs.
Make certain to follow any facility guidelines regarding vehicle preparation, such as draining fluids or disconnecting the battery, to keep your vehicle in top condition during storage.

How Do I Handle Storage Unit Insurance Claims?
Handling storage unit insurance claims requires a clear understanding of the insurance claim process.
First, gather evidence of the damage or loss, including photos and a detailed inventory. Contact your insurance provider promptly to start filing claims.
Follow their specific instructions, providing any necessary documentation. Stay organized and keep records of all communications.
Respond quickly to any requests for additional information to guarantee a smooth claims process. Patience and persistence are key.
